Case Manager - RN (Healthcare)
Identify the patient/family's physical, psychosocial, and environmental needs and reassess as needed
Provide nursing services in accordance with the POC.
Document problems, appropriate goals, interventions, and patient/family response to hospice care.
Collaborate with the patient/family attending physician and other members of the IDT in providing patient and family care.
Instruct patient/family in self-care techniques when appropriate.
Supervise ancillary personnel and delegates responsibilities when required.
Complete and submit accurate and relevant clinical notes regarding the patient's condition.
Perform supervisory visits to the patient's residence.
